In this enlightening discussion, Simon Baines, Managing Director of Access Education, Laura Tressler, Director of Client Management, and Emma Slater, Head of Learning, share their insights on AI's transformative role in education. They explore how AI can automate school operations, enhance personalized learning, and support student interventions. The trio addresses fears surrounding AI's impact on teaching jobs and data security while offering practical steps for schools to adopt AI. They envision a future where AI, along with VR, shapes a more equitable education landscape.

INSIGHT

Operations Drive Educational Impact

  • Access Education focuses on operational software (HR, payroll, finance) that frees budget for teaching.
  • Improving organisational efficiency indirectly improves educational outcomes by releasing resources for classrooms.
INSIGHT

Feedback Loops Power Product Relevance

  • Access Education organises product, customer success, engineering and sales teams to create a feedback loop between schools and development.
  • Continuous investment and school feedback drive product relevance and long-term growth.
ADVICE

Align Tech With Real School Problems

  • Combine deep customer insight with engineering expertise when introducing new tech to schools.
  • Always align technology projects to specific school problems rather than deploying attractive but irrelevant tools.
